Hip Young Guitar Slinger and "His Heavy Friends" focuses on Jimmy Page's work as a session guitarist for the Immediate and Pye labels in the '60s. The first disc includes the poppier end of his work behind Gregory Phillips, the Kinks and Nico, while the second disc finds him in more familiar territory backing English blues masters like Eric Clapton, John Mayall and Jeff Beck. Fans of Led Zeppelin won't find any lost gems here, but this collection does shine a light on Page's successful pre-Zep music career. [Castle issued a remastered edition in 2007.] ~ Al Campbell, All Music Guide
